The Great Gatsby (1926) Facts
| Director(s) | Herbert Brenon |
| Producer(s) | Adolph Zukor, Jesse L. Lasky |
| Featured Cast | Warner Baxter, Lois Wilson, Neil Hamilton, Georgia Hale, William Powell |
| Total Facts | 3 |
Although a lost film, the trailer survived and is one of the 50 films in the 3-disk boxed DVD set called "More Treasures from American Film Archives, 1894-1931" (2004), compiled by the National Film Preservation Foundation from 5 American film archives. It is preserved by the Library of Congress (AFI/Jack Tillmany collection) and has a running time of 1 minute.
No prints of this film are known to survive.
The Broadway production of "The Great Catsby" by Owen Davis based on the novel by F. Scott Fitzgerald opened at the Ambassador Theater on February 2, 1926, ran for 112 performances and directed by future movie director George Cukor.
